The inclusion of an American bison on this $2 Yellowstone National Park 150th Anniversary Note is a nod not only to the most popular resident of the park, but also to the history of the American bison on American currency. From paper notes and historic circulation coins to modern bullion specimens, the bison is prominent in American money designs.
In 1901, the American bison made its debut on American money when the $10 United States Note was issued with the powerful image of the American bison. In 1913, James Earle Fraser chose the American bison to capture the wild, untamable nature of America on the reverse of the redesigned nickel. Today, that same design lives on with the American Gold Buffalo bullion coin.
Obverse designs on these $2 Yellowstone National Park 150th Anniversary Bison Legal Tender Notes include several images from within Yellowstone National Park. The American bison at the center is impossible to miss. Its massive, muscular figure is shown in left-profile relief with its head raised and its sharp horns on display. On the left, Old Faithful spews out steam and smoke.
Reverse visuals on Yellowstone National Park 150th Anniversary Bison Legal Tender Notes feature the original 1976 design. When the $2 Federal Reserve Note was introduced in 1976, an 1818 oil painting from John Trumbull was chosen for the reverse. This scene captures the moment the Declaration of Independence was delivered to the Continental Congress.
